Top landmarks in Hamilton

Learn more about Hamilton

Hamilton is well-known for its riverfront and university life, featuring attractions such as Spooky Nook Sports Champion Mill and Butler County Courthouse. The city has something for everyone including sights like Pyramid Hill Sculpture Park and Walden Ponds Golf Club within a small-town setting.

Pyramid Hill Sculpture Park is a huge outdoor museum with larger scale pieces of sculpture placed throughout a serene environment of meadows and forests.

Things to do in Hamilton

Nestled by a winding river, this charming small town boasts lush parks and vibrant flower-filled gardens. Explore serene lakes through kayaking, enjoy birdwatching in tranquil forests, or get lost in local art scenes. With its mix of nature and creativity, it’s a delightful getaway for all travelers.

  • Kings IslandOpens in a new window – Dive into a day of thrills at Kings Island, a premier amusement park brimming with exhilarating rides and attractions. From roller coasters that soar to dizzying heights to gentle rides perfect for the little ones, there’s something for everyone. Don’t forget to explore the beautiful landscaping, which features vibrant flowers and charming small-town vibes throughout the park.
  • Pyramid Hill Sculpture ParkOpens in a new window – Stroll through the breathtaking Pyramid Hill Sculpture Park, where art and nature blend seamlessly. This expansive sculpture garden invites you to explore its trails dotted with striking sculptures, all set against a picturesque backdrop of rivers and lush greenery. It’s a peaceful retreat that sparks creativity and offers a moment to appreciate both nature and artistry.
  • Butler County CourthouseOpens in a new window – Visit the historic Butler County Courthouse, an architectural gem that reflects the rich history of the area. Admire its stunning design and learn about local governance while soaking in the surrounding small-town atmosphere. It’s a great spot for a quick photo op and a glimpse into Hamilton's civic life.
  • Fitton Center For Creative ArtsOpens in a new window – Get inspired at the Fitton Center For Creative Arts, where a variety of artistic expressions come to life. Attend a performance or art exhibit, or participate in one of the many engaging workshops offered. This vibrant center reflects the community’s passion for creativity and is a hub for local artists.
  • Lane Public LibraryOpens in a new window – Discover a world of knowledge at Lane Public Library, a welcoming space for readers and learners alike. Browse through an extensive collection of books, enjoy cozy reading nooks, and participate in community events. It’s a perfect spot to unwind and connect with fellow book enthusiasts.

Best time to go to Hamilton

Hamilton exper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 30.4°F (-0.9°C), while July is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 75.6°F (24.2°C). April is usually the wettest month. April, June, and July are the peak travel months in Hamilton, attracting a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ny, with light rainfall. On the other hand, October to December tend to be quieter times to visit, marked by light rainfall and mostly sunny to mostly cloudy conditions.
